Taranjit Singh Sandhu honoured at SGPC office
Amritsar, August 25, 2023: Indian Ambassador to the United States Of America (USA) Taranjit Singh Sandhu Today paid obeisance at Sachkhand Sri Harmandir Sahib. He was honoured at The Shiromani Gurdwara Parbandhak Committee (SGPC) member Bhai Rajinder Singh Mehta, Surjit Singh Bhitewad, secretary Partap Singh and other officials.
During this time Taranjit Singh Sandhu Visited SGPC headquarters Teja Singh Samundri Hall named after his Grandfather and remembered his elders.
On this occasion, Taranjit Singh Sandhu Said that Sachkhand Sri Harmandir Sahib Is the center of faith for the entire Humanity, from where human gets Spiritual power.
He said that he visits Obeisance at Every year to Sachkhand Sri Harmandir Sahib, to seek Blessings of the Guru. He said that his
Family has a close relationship with the SGPC. He said his elder Teja Singh Samundri contributed greatly during the establishment of SGPC and participated
In many morchas (fronts). He said that it
Is a matter of pride for our family that
Teja Singh was a high-ranking leader of
The Sikh community.
Speaking further, Taranjit Singh Sandhu
Said that the present time is the era of
Technology and the Sikh community
Should also make more efforts to make
Students experts in technical education
In its educational institutions.
